ls

El comando ls (list) lista el contenido de un directorio (contenidos de todo tipo, incluyendo directorios). Por defecto muestra los contenidos del directorio actual, ordenando los contenidos a mostrar alfabéticamente y no mostrando aquellos que comiencen por el carácter ".".

Opciones

Este comando admite el uso de comodines ("?" representando un carácter y "*" representando cualquier número de caracteres, incluyendo la cadena vacía).

Las opciones pueden combinarse. De esta forma, el comando

ls -l -r

.. es equivalente a:

ls -lr

  • -a: Muestra en el listado de contenidos aquellos ficheros que comienzan por ".", incluyendo "." (directorio actual) y ".." (directorio padre).
  • -A: Muestra en el listado de contenidos aquellos ficheros que comienzan por ".", sin incluir "." (directorio actual) y ".." (directorio padre).
  • -b: Muestra los caracteres no gráficos como secuencias de caracteres estilo C.
  • --color: Muestra los contenidos en el listado con diferentes colores en función del tipo.
  • -C: Lista los contenidos en columnas.
  • -d: Muestra en el listado los directorios, no sus contenidos (véase un ejemplo más adelante).
  • -l: Utiliza un formato de listado largo que incluye información adicional sobre cada fichero y directorio: tipo de fichero (si es o no un directorio), permisos del fichero, número de enlaces duros, nombre del propietario, nombre del grupo, tamaño, fecha (normalmente de última modificación) y nombre del fichero.
  • -r: Muestra los contenidos ordenados en sentido inverso.
  • -R: Muestra los contenidos de forma recursiva.
  • -t: Ordena los contenidos según la fecha de modificación (los más nuevos en primer lugar).
  • -directorio: Muestra los contenidos del directorio indicado:

Comando LS. Ejemplo de uso

Ejemplos
  • ls -a: Muestra todos los contenidos del directorio actual, incluyendo aquellos que comienzan por ".":

Comando LS. Ejemplo de uso

  • ls -d */: Muestra todos los directorios (y solo los directorios) contenidos en el directorio actual:

Comando LS. Ejemplo de uso

  • ls -l: Muestra el listado con un formato largo:

Comando LS. Ejemplo de uso

  • ls -l otrodoc.odt: Muestra la información asociada al fichero otrodoc.odt.
  • ls -lr: Muestra los contenidos del directorio en formato largo y ordenados en sentido inverso.
  • ls *.jpg: Muestra todos los ficheros con extensión "jpg".
Categoría
Archivos y directorios
Submitted by admin on Mon, 12/03/2018 - 22:11